October

  • 11: Meditrinalia -- A celebration commemorating wine where the old vintage and new vintage are mixed with the blessings of the goddess - Meditrina (goddess of health, longevity and wine).
  • 12: Augustalia, celebrated from 14 AD in honor of the divinized Augustus, established in 19 BC with a new altar and sacrifice to Fortuna Redux
  • 13: Fontinalia in honour of Fons (god of divine and purified waters)
  • 14: ceremonies to mark a restoration of the Temple of the Penates Dei on the Velian Hill
  • 15 (Ides): October Horse sacrifice to Mars in the Campus Martius; also Feriae of Jupiter
  • 16: Lupinalia, the Festival of Wolves
  • 19: Armilustrium, a dies religiosus in honour of Mars
